Heil Harvesting, Ulysses KS/Limon CO | 29.5 feet of cutter bar on a 930 deere (why the hell is it not 30 on a 930?)
29.5ft * 12in/1ft = 354in
354in * 1 section/3in = 118 sections
1 half section/end * 2 ends = 2 half sections
354in * 1 guard/6in = 59 guards
59 guards - 1 guard to account for one triple guard to compensate for ends = 58 guards + 1 triple guard
so by that 118 sections, 2 half sections, 58 standard guards, 1 triple guard.
